White Lake (White Lake Township, Michigan)
Lake in the state of Michigan, United States /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
White Lake[2] is an all-sports, 540-acre (220 ha) lake in White Lake Township, Michigan.[3]

It is the sixth largest lake in Oakland County.[4]
Potawatomi, Chippewa and Ottawa Native Americans lived, traveled and camped in this area including on the shores of White Lake which they called “white” or “clear” and that is where the name of the lake and township originated.
